Key Concepts

Property To add numbers with different signs, find the difference of their absolute values. The sum will have the sign of the addend with the greater absolute value.

Explanation This is a tug of war between the Positive Team and the Negative Team! Find the difference in their strengths by subtracting the smaller absolute value from the larger one. The team with the bigger muscle (greater absolute value) wins the tug of war and gets to decide if the final answer is positive or negative.
